Voice + Agents Guide: Turning Spoken Half-Thoughts Directly into Code
every · x · 2026-08-06
Every released a practical guide on combining voice with AI agents, arguing that speech is more than a typing shortcut—it's a way to transform knowledge work.
Agents allow users to capture messy conversations or half-formed ideas without first structuring them into text or code. Typical workflows include: feeding a 19-minute customer complaint recording to a coding agent to generate a patch, talking through an essay outline, or dictating context and tone for an agent to draft an email. The core loop is: capture thought, add context, define outcome, let the agent act, then review.
